Abnormal Vaginal Bleeding in Women Desiring Contraception Who Are Taking Anticoagulation Therapy
2018
A 30-year-old nulligravid woman is referred to you for heavy menstrual cycles. Although her menstrual cycles were previously light, she was recently diagnosed with an unprovoked lower extremity venous thromboembolism and is taking anticoagulation therapy after a negative thrombophilia workup.
